The Role of Mobile Responsiveness in Web Design
Understanding the Necessity of Mobile Responsiveness
In an era where mobile devices dominate internet usage, mobile responsiveness is no longer optional; it’s a necessity. A responsive web design ensures that your website functions well on all devices, enhancing user experience and SEO.
The Rise of Mobile Usage
With over half of all web traffic coming from mobile devices, it’s essential to prioritize mobile-friendly designs. Brands that fail to adapt risk losing significant traffic and potential customers.
User Experience Across Devices
A responsive design adjusts seamlessly to different screen sizes, ensuring a consistent and enjoyable user experience. This adaptability is critical in retaining visitors and reducing bounce rates.
Impact on SEO
Google considers mobile-friendliness as a ranking factor. Websites that are not mobile-responsive can suffer lower rankings, making it harder for potential customers to find your business online.
Best Practices for Mobile Responsiveness
Implementing best practices like flexible grids, responsive images, and touch-friendly navigation can vastly improve your website's mobile performance. Regular testing across devices is also crucial.
Conclusion
Mobile responsiveness is a fundamental aspect of modern web design. By ensuring your website is optimized for all users, you enhance both user experience and search engine rankings, paving the way for greater success.
